Starbucks Teams Up With Software Firm That Ran Waiterless Restaurants
  • 5 years ago
Business Insider reports coffee giant Starbucks announced a new deal with tech startup Brightloom on Monday.
Starbucks granted Brightloom a license for elements of the coffee giant's software.
In exchange, Starbucks now has an equity stake in the startup and a seat on its board of directors.
Brightloom previously operated a restaurant chain where customers ordered via kiosk, with no interaction with employees.
